>> Hi Davey,
>>
>> To clarify, the "DNS Load Balancing" side meeting will not be concerned
>> primarily with nameserver selection.  Instead, the topic of the side
>> meeting will be about using DNS to perform load balancing of other services
>> and protocols.
>>
>> I think this draft's term ("Nameserver Selection") is good, and we should
>> use that to distinguish it from "DNS Load Balancing".
>>
>> There is certainly some overlap between these notions (as each can be
>> used to implement the other in some fashion), but I would prefer to let
>> both topics mature separately for now.
>>
>> --Ben

>> Internet-Draft draft-zhang-dnsop-ns-selection-00.txt is now available.
>>
>>    Title:   Secure Nameserver Selection Algorithm for DNS Resolvers
>>    Authors: Fenglu Zhang
>>             Baojun Liu
>>             Linjian Song
>>             Shumon Huque
>>    Name:    draft-zhang-dnsop-ns-selection-00.txt
>>    Pages:   18
>>    Dates:   2024-07-02
>>
>> Abstract:
>>
>>    Nameserver selection algorithms employed by DNS resolvers are not
>>    currently standardized in the DNS protocol, and this has lead to
>>    variation in the methods being used by implementations in the field.
>>    Recent research has shown that some of these implementations suffer
>>    from significant security vulnerabilities.  This document provides an
>>    in-depth analysis of nameserver selection utilized by mainstream DNS
>>    software and summarizes uncovered vulnerabilities.  Furthermore, it
>>    provides recommendations to defend against these security and
>>    availability risks.  Designers and operators of recursive resolvers
>>    can adopt these recommendations to improve the security and stability
>>    of the DNS.
